About The Position

The Director of Revenue Management will be responsible for the management and execution of LivCor’s revenue management strategy and process, extending from pre-acquisition through to the ongoing optimization to disposition. The duties include serving as LivCor’s central pricing authority, managing the Revenue Management System and working with LivCor’s executive team to set revenue strategy and process, review performance, and monitor compliance. The DRM will also assist with project management, budgeting, forecasting, and data analysis as needed.
